Factors Influencing Sash Window Renovation Costs
The cost of renovating sash windows can vary significantly based upon a number of factors. Understanding these variables can assist house owners make notified choices regarding their renovation tasks.
1. Condition of the Windows
The initial condition of the windows determines the extent of renovation needed. Windows that are simply drafty may need less work than those that are severely rotted or broken.
Categories of Condition:Good Condition: Requires minor repairs and repainting.Moderate Condition: Needs glazing and some wood repairs.Poor Condition: Requires extensive repairs and even complete replacement of parts.2. Type of Wood
Sash windows are typically made from wood, and the type of wood used can affect renovation expenses. Hardwoods like mahogany or oak are more expensive than softwoods like pine.
3. Geographical Location
Renovation expenses can differ by region due to differences in labor expenses and material schedule. Urban locations usually see greater expenses compared to rural areas.
4. Professional vs. DIY Restoration
Employing experts typically ensures quality work but can significantly increase the total cost. On the other hand, DIY projects can conserve money but may need abilities and tools that some property owners might lack.
5. Additional Features
Property owners who wish to update their windows with additional functions-- such as double glazing, brand-new hardware, or customized sashes-- can expect higher renovation expenses.
Breakdown of Sash Window Renovation Costs
To offer a clearer picture, the following table details the estimated expenses associated with various elements of sash window renovation.
Renovation AspectTypical Cost (per window)Basic Repairs (minor fixes)₤ 150 - ₤ 300Total Restoration₤ 500 - ₤ 1,000Replacement of Sash Cords₤ 100 - ₤ 200Glazing Repairs₤ 100 - ₤ 300Painting and Finishing₤ 100 - ₤ 300Setup of Double Glazing₤ 400 - ₤ 800Full Replacement of Sashes₤ 600 - ₤ 1,200Approximated Total for Full Renovation₤ 1,000 - ₤ 2,500
The overall renovation cost can range significantly based on the intricacy of the work required. Homeowners should budget between ₤ 1,000 and ₤ 2,500 for a full renovation of a single sash window, bearing in mind that these expenses might differ.

A1: The timeframe can vary based upon the extent of the work needed, however a common renovation task may take anywhere from a couple of days to a number of weeks for several windows.
Q2: Is it worth refurbishing old sash windows?
A2: Yes, remodeling old sash windows can enhance energy performance, improve aesthetic appeal, and significantly increase residential or commercial property worth, specifically in historical homes.
Q3: Can I change the glass in my sash windows with double glazing?
A3: Yes, it is possible to retrofit sash windows with double-glazed systems, however this might need professional help to make sure an appropriate fit without jeopardizing the window's original character.
Q4: What's the very best way to maintain sash windows when renovated?
A4: Regular maintenance, consisting of painting, examining for drafts, and making sure appropriate operation, will extend the life of remodelled sash windows. Checking weatherstripping and making any essential repairs without delay can also assist maintain efficiency.
Q5: Should I bring back or replace my sash windows?
A5: If the windows are structurally sound but inefficient, restoration is usually advised. However, if they are beyond repair or have extreme rot, replacement might be the more practical and cost-effective alternative in the long run.
